Overview

Postcode E13 0SF is located in a major urban area, within the Green Street West ward of Newham in the London region, and forms part of the Upton Park area. It has high deprivation and low crime levels, with around 42.5 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 67% below the London average of 130 per 1,000. The average income per household in Upton Park is £53,561 per year. The nearest station is Upton Park, about 0.3 miles away. There are 12 primary and 4 secondary schools in the area.

Frequently asked questions about E13 0SF

Is E13 0SF (Upton Park) safe?

The area around E13 0SF records about 43 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a low crime rate for England: it scores 3 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across London as a whole the rate is about 130 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are theft from the person, violence and sexual offences and anti-social behaviour.

What is the average house price near E13 0SF?

The median sale price around E13 0SF in Upton Park is £493,000 (about £465 per square foot) based on 36 registered sales according to HM Land Registry data.

What schools are near E13 0SF?

There are 20 schools close to E13 0SF, including Upton Cross Primary School (Good), Plaistow Primary School (Good) and Selwyn Primary School. Ratings are from the latest Ofsted inspections.

What is the nearest station to E13 0SF?

The closest station to E13 0SF is Upton Park in TfL zone 3, about 441 m away, serving the District and Hammersmith and City lines.

How deprived is the area around E13 0SF?

E13 0SF scores 7 out of 10 on the deprivation scale, where 10 is the most deprived. Its neighbourhood ranks 10,942 of 32,844 in England on the official Index of Multiple Deprivation (rank 1 is the most deprived).
